INSTRUCTIONS
Gut herrings, cut off heads, wash thoroughly & dry. Rub with salt, inside &
out. Coat with flour & fry in hot fat until golden brown. Put in
earthenware jar with onion, mustard seed & peppercorns. Mix vinegar with
cool, boiled water & pour over herrings. Let stand for at least 2 days.
TIME INCLUDES MARINATING TIME
